Labelled as a vegetable for nutritional purposes, tomatoes are a good source of vitamin C and the phytochemical lycopene. It grows in the rocky area. The plant can be erect with short stems or vine-like with long, spreading stems. The self-propelled mechanical tomato harvester, developed in the early 1960s by engineers working in cooperation with plant breeders, handles virtually all packing tomatoes grown in California. PROBLEMS : Tomatoes are susceptible to many pests and diseases such as blights, blossom end-rot, wilts, bacterial and viral diseases, tomato hornworms, aphids, beetles, and cutworms. There are over 100 species of bush tomato however only 6 are known to be edible and some are poisonous, so you’re safer to buy than forage for your own unless you’re with someone who knows what they’re doing. The plant is now grown commercially throughout the world. It did not attain widespread popularity in the United States until the early 20th century.
